I am trying to make sense of my application for a study permit was rejected. I am intending to be an exchange student there from Sept 2019 to May 2020. My passport runs until November 2020. All my documents are in order.
The visa officer stated their reason to fail my application as,'You have not produced evidence that you are in possession of a passport and that it is valid for the duration of your stay in Canada.'. I don't understand how they could fail it on this.

Does anyone have any experience with this? I wish to appeal the decision but not sure how to.

There is no appeal process available. Are you sure you filled the correct dates in the application form and your acceptance letter lists the correct date for your internship? Do you have a copy you can check?

Best thing you can do is send them a webform with an explanation and hope they reconsider.
